Role Overview
Due to continued growth, we are recruiting multiple Kitchen & Bathroom Site Managers to deliver planned refurbishment works within social housing properties across South London, Croydon, and Guildford.
Each role will be site-based, with responsibility for managing kitchen and bathroom replacement programmes from start to completion, ensuring works are delivered safely, on time, within budget, and to a high standard of quality and customer satisfaction.
Key Responsibilities
Site Management & Delivery
- Take full responsibility for the day-to-day management of a designated site
- Oversee kitchen and bathroom replacement works in line with programme requirements
- Manage subcontractors, trades, and direct labour on site
- Ensure works are delivered to specification and within agreed timelines
Health & Safety
- Enforce strict adherence to Health & Safety regulations and company procedures
- Carry out site inductions, toolbox talks, and ensure RAMS are followed
- Maintain a safe working environment, particularly within occupied homes
Quality Control
- Conduct regular site inspections to ensure high standards of workmanship
- Manage snagging and ensure timely completion of defects
- Ensure compliance with client and contract specifications
Customer & Client Liaison
- Act as the primary point of contact for residents on site
- Manage resident expectations and minimise disruption during works
- Handle queries and complaints in a professional and timely manner
- Liaise with client representatives and contract managers
Programme & Resource Management
- Manage site programme and ensure key milestones are achieved
- Coordinate labour, materials, and deliveries effectively
- Identify and resolve any delays or issues impacting progress
Documentation & Reporting
- Maintain accurate site records, including daily diaries
- Complete progress reports and required compliance documentation
- Ensure all handover documentation is completed correctly
